Variable Documentation

◆ adopt_lock

constexpr _GLIBCXX17_INLINE adopt_lock_t std::adopt_lock
constexpr

Tag used to make a scoped lock take ownership of a locked mutex.

Definition at line 148 of file std_mutex.h.

◆ defer_lock

constexpr _GLIBCXX17_INLINE defer_lock_t std::defer_lock
constexpr

Tag used to prevent a scoped lock from acquiring ownership of a mutex.

Definition at line 142 of file std_mutex.h.

◆ try_to_lock

constexpr _GLIBCXX17_INLINE try_to_lock_t std::try_to_lock
constexpr

Tag used to prevent a scoped lock from blocking if a mutex is locked.

Definition at line 145 of file std_mutex.h.
